Home Made Cold Brew (みずだし)

So a colleague in office told me that he likes cold brew coffee.  I had tried one in Starbucks but was not really impressed by it so I dismissed it as some hipster brewing method for people with too much time.  However, I also know this colleague of mine to have quite a distinguished palate - at least for coffee.  So if he said cold brew is good, then it must be good.  Perhaps the one in Starbucks had not been up to my standard, so I thought I'll try to brew one myself.

The brewing instrument I use this time is a Hario Mizudashi pot.  I bought this pot in Batam 6 years ago and used it to brew tea instead....  Well, now I use it to brew coffee.  

As for the coffee itself, I used 100% Java Arabica at 100 grams.  The ground has to be medium coarse.  A good reason for a medium coarse ground is so that the water can pass through the ground coffee and then through the filter when you pour it in.  Coffee connoisseurs might say that it is for better taste and less grimy final solution (whether coarse or fine you'll still see some sludge deposit at the bottom of the container).  Well, I'll just say use medium coarse ground and let it stay at that.
